
HTML设置繁体字的方法包括:使用Unicode字符编码、CSS字体族、Google字体API、繁体字转换工具。 在这四种方法中,最常见且最有效的是使用Unicode字符编码和CSS字体族。
Unicode字符编码
Unicode字符编码是一种通用的字符编码标准,可以支持全球范围内的各种字符,包括简体和繁体中文。通过设置HTML文档的字符编码为UTF-8,可以确保繁体中文字符被正确显示。
<!DOCTYPE html>
<html lang="zh-Hant">
<head>
<meta charset="UTF-8">
<title>繁體字示例</title>
</head>
<body>
<p>這是一個繁體字示例。</p>
</body>
</html>
在这个例子中,通过设置<meta charset="UTF-8">来指定字符编码为UTF-8,并且使用lang="zh-Hant"来指定文档的语言为繁体中文。
一、使用Unicode字符编码
Unicode字符编码是最基础也是最广泛使用的方法,因为它能够支持几乎所有的语言和字符。使用UTF-8编码可以确保繁体字的正确显示,这也是大多数HTML文档的默认编码。
1、设置HTML文档的字符编码
在HTML文档的<head>部分添加以下代码:
<meta charset="UTF-8">
这样可以确保文档使用UTF-8编码,从而支持繁体字显示。
2、使用繁体字内容
直接在HTML文档中输入繁体字内容,无需任何额外设置。例如:
<!DOCTYPE html>
<html lang="zh-Hant">
<head>
<meta charset="UTF-8">
<title>繁體字示例</title>
</head>
<body>
<p>這是一個繁體字示例。</p>
</body>
</html>
二、使用CSS字体族
使用CSS字体族可以确保浏览器在显示繁体字时使用合适的字体。通过指定字体族,可以提高繁体字的显示效果。
1、指定字体族
在CSS文件或HTML文档的<style>标签中添加以下代码:
body {
font-family: "PingFang TC", "Microsoft JhengHei", "Heiti TC", "sans-serif";
}
这里的font-family属性指定了一组字体族,浏览器会按照顺序选择可用的字体进行显示。
2、应用CSS样式
在HTML文档中应用指定的CSS样式,例如:
<!DOCTYPE html>
<html lang="zh-Hant">
<head>
<meta charset="UTF-8">
<title>繁體字示例</title>
<style>
body {
font-family: "PingFang TC", "Microsoft JhengHei", "Heiti TC", "sans-serif";
}
</style>
</head>
<body>
<p>這是一個繁體字示例。</p>
</body>
</html>
通过指定字体族,可以确保繁体字在不同设备和浏览器上的一致性显示。
三、使用Google字体API
Google字体API提供了一些专门支持繁体字的字体,可以通过引入这些字体来提高繁体字的显示效果。
1、引入Google字体
在HTML文档的<head>部分添加以下代码:
<link href="https://fonts.googleapis.com/css2?family=Noto+Sans+TC&display=swap" rel="stylesheet">
2、应用Google字体
在CSS文件或HTML文档的<style>标签中添加以下代码:
body {
font-family: 'Noto Sans TC', sans-serif;
}
这样可以确保繁体字使用Google提供的高质量字体进行显示。
四、使用繁体字转换工具
如果您的内容是以简体字输入的,可以使用繁体字转换工具将其转换为繁体字。
1、在线转换工具
有很多在线工具可以将简体字转换为繁体字,例如:
2、程序化转换
如果您需要在程序中进行转换,可以使用一些编程语言库,例如Python的opencc库:
from opencc import OpenCC
cc = OpenCC('s2t') # Simplified to Traditional
text = "这是一个简体字示例。"
converted = cc.convert(text)
print(converted) # 輸出:這是一個繁體字示例。
五、结合多种方法
在实际项目中,可以结合使用以上多种方法,确保繁体字在不同设备和浏览器上的一致性显示。
1、设置字符编码和字体族
首先设置HTML文档的字符编码为UTF-8,并指定适当的字体族:
<!DOCTYPE html>
<html lang="zh-Hant">
<head>
<meta charset="UTF-8">
<title>繁體字示例</title>
<style>
body {
font-family: "PingFang TC", "Microsoft JhengHei", "Heiti TC", "sans-serif";
}
</style>
</head>
<body>
<p>這是一個繁體字示例。</p>
</body>
</html>
2、引入Google字体
引入Google字体以提高显示效果:
<!DOCTYPE html>
<html lang="zh-Hant">
<head>
<meta charset="UTF-8">
<title>繁體字示例</title>
<link href="https://fonts.googleapis.com/css2?family=Noto+Sans+TC&display=swap" rel="stylesheet">
<style>
body {
font-family: 'Noto Sans TC', "PingFang TC", "Microsoft JhengHei", "Heiti TC", "sans-serif";
}
</style>
</head>
<body>
<p>這是一個繁體字示例。</p>
</body>
</html>
3、使用繁体字转换工具
如果需要将简体字内容转换为繁体字,可以使用在线工具或编程语言库进行转换。
六、实战案例
以下是一个结合了所有方法的完整HTML示例:
<!DOCTYPE html>
<html lang="zh-Hant">
<head>
<meta charset="UTF-8">
<title>繁體字示例</title>
<link href="https://fonts.googleapis.com/css2?family=Noto+Sans+TC&display=swap" rel="stylesheet">
<style>
body {
font-family: 'Noto Sans TC', "PingFang TC", "Microsoft JhengHei", "Heiti TC", "sans-serif";
}
</style>
</head>
<body>
<p>這是一個繁體字示例。</p>
<p>使用UTF-8字符編碼確保繁體字顯示正確。</p>
<p>指定合適的字體族提高顯示效果。</p>
<p>引入Google字體進一步優化顯示。</p>
<p>如果需要,可以使用工具將簡體字轉換為繁體字。</p>
</body>
</html>
七、总结
通过以上方法,可以有效地在HTML文档中设置和显示繁体字。无论是通过设置字符编码、指定字体族,还是引入Google字体和使用转换工具,都可以确保繁体字在不同设备和浏览器上的一致性显示。这样不仅可以提高用户体验,还可以确保内容的可读性和美观性。
在实际项目中,建议结合使用多种方法,以确保最好的显示效果。如果您的项目需要团队协作和管理,可以考虑使用研发项目管理系统PingCode和通用项目协作软件Worktile,以提高工作效率和协作效果。
相关问答FAQs:
1. 如何在HTML中设置繁体字?
在HTML中设置繁体字是通过CSS样式表来实现的。您可以使用以下步骤来设置繁体字:
-
首先,确保您的网页上引用了正确的繁体字体文件,这样才能正确显示繁体字。您可以从互联网上下载适合您需求的繁体字体文件。
-
其次,使用CSS样式表来指定您想要使用的繁体字体。在CSS中,使用
font-family属性来指定字体名称,并在字体名称后面添加'繁体字体名称'来指定繁体字体。 -
最后,在HTML中将要显示繁体字的元素上应用该CSS样式。例如,如果您想要在一个段落中显示繁体字,可以使用
<p>标签,并为该标签添加对应的CSS样式。
2. 繁体字在HTML中的兼容性如何?
在大多数现代浏览器中,繁体字都有良好的兼容性。然而,某些旧版本的浏览器可能无法正确显示繁体字,或者可能只能显示默认的字体样式。
为了提高繁体字在不同浏览器中的兼容性,您可以使用Web字体(Web Fonts)来加载自定义的繁体字体。通过使用Web字体,您可以确保在任何浏览器上都能正确显示繁体字。
3. 如何在不同语言环境下设置繁体字?
在HTML中,可以通过设置lang属性来指定不同的语言环境。如果您想要在不同语言环境下显示繁体字,可以按照以下步骤操作:
-
首先,在HTML的
<html>标签上添加lang属性,并设置为对应的语言环境代码。例如,对于中文繁体,可以将lang属性设置为zh-Hant。 -
其次,为每个需要显示繁体字的元素添加对应的CSS样式。使用选择器来选择特定的元素,并在样式中设置繁体字体。
-
最后,根据不同的语言环境,使用条件语句或JavaScript来动态设置繁体字的样式。这样可以根据用户的语言环境自动选择要显示的繁体字体。
请注意,确保您的繁体字体文件包含了所需的繁体字形,以便在不同语言环境下正确显示繁体字。
文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/3020294